Oligofructose is found naturally in foods like chicory root, asparagus, bananas, artichokes, garlic, onions, wheat, barley, rye and many others. It is a type of carbohydrate, classed as a soluble dietary fibre, which is broken down in the large intestine where it feeds the gut-friendly bacteria. It therefore acts as a prebiotic, providing many health benefits. Oligofructose doesn’t cause sugar spikes and, due to its high fibre content, keeps you feeling fuller for longer.

Our bars have low moisture content and we have carefully selected ingredients known for their stability over shelf life. This, together with the extremely high quality, well-sealed packaging we use ensures the products remain at their very best.

The cardboard packaging for our TREK bars is 100% recyclable, biodegradable and made with wood from a sustainable forest.

Our bars film packaging is not currently recyclable. This is something we’re looking into very seriously in order to find a suitable material that has a neutral overall effect on the environment and the necessary barrier properties needed to protect the quality of our bars.

To date, we have not managed to find a supplier where the material used is manufactured in a way that produces less carbon impact than the lifecycle of the non-recyclable film we currently use. We are currently investigating a number of industry wide incentives in order for us to tackle this issue. Hopefully we will be able to have a plan in place within the next 12 months.

Currently we do not source Fair Trade or organic ingredients. This is mainly due to production costs and the difficulties of sourcing these ingredients. It is tricky to tick all the boxes and keep the prices reasonable enough for our customers. We are working hard to find a way to use Fair Trade and/or organic ingredients in the future.

We can confirm that our Protein Nut Bars are vegan and do not contain any ingredients of animal origin.

We voluntarily declare ‘may contain milk’ on our packaging because there may be a chance of cross-contamination. This is due to some of the ingredients used in our bars being processed in factories where other products are made.

As milk is an allergen, we wish to ensure the relevant information is provided to our customers so they can make informed decisions as to whether they purchase our products. To find out more on why we declare ‘may contain milk’, please visit The Vegan Society link which may be of interest.
